The Evolution of Data Encryption: From Traditional Methods to Quantum-Resistant Algorithms

The field of data encryption has undergone significant transformations in recent years, driven by advancements in quantum computing and the increasing sophistication of cyber threats. Traditional encryption methods, such as symmetric and asymmetric key encryption, are being gradually replaced by more advanced techniques like homomorphic encryption and zero-knowledge proofs. The Certificate in Data Encryption for Network Security covers these emerging trends, enabling professionals to stay ahead of the curve and develop expertise in implementing quantum-resistant algorithms. For instance, the use of lattice-based cryptography and code-based cryptography are being explored as potential solutions to mitigate the risks associated with quantum computing.

The Rise of Cloud-Based Data Encryption: Challenges and Opportunities

The increasing adoption of cloud computing has created new challenges for data encryption, as sensitive information is now being stored and transmitted over cloud-based infrastructure. The Certificate in Data Encryption for Network Security addresses these challenges, providing professionals with the knowledge and skills to design and implement cloud-based encryption solutions. This includes the use of cloud-based key management systems, secure multi-party computation, and other advanced techniques to ensure the confidentiality, integrity, and availability of cloud-stored data. For example, the use of cloud-based encryption can help organizations comply with regulatory requirements, such as the General Data Protection Regulation (GDPR) and the Health Insurance Portability and Accountability Act (HIPAA).
